James “Jim” Dickerson, 78, of Montezuma, passed away Sunday, September 26th, 2021 at Union Hospital in Terre Haute.
Jim was born in Crawfordsville, Indiana to Robert and Minnie Mae Delores Love Dickerson on July 17th, 1943.
Jim was formerly a member of Montezuma Fire Department, being involved for over 20 years. He was also a member of the N.R.A. Jim was retired from Panhandle Eastern Pipeline.
He is preceded in death by both parents and one son, Timothy Allen Dickerson, who passed away June 12th, 2008.
Jim is survived by his loving wife, Linda “Kay” Dickerson of Montezuma; children, Tammy Guoli (Tom) of Montezuma, and Jeff Dickerson (Kim) of North Terre Haute; siblings, Jerry Dickerson (Kay) of Florida, and Anita Crowder (Bill) of Rockville; several grandchildren; several great-grandchildren; several nieces and nephews.
